"Next we will take a look at how you form a bead with the scraper. The first part of this action is to mark both sides of the bead. You can use either a diamond pointed scraping tool or in this case I'll be using a parting tool. Basic diamond shape. Again you go in below and mark both sides. You then take your flat scraper and just start rotating it side to side until you get the desired shape. Remember you need to keep the edge of the tool down below the center line to get a smoother cut and you keep rotating the tool back and forth until you get the size and the shape of the bead you are looking for."
